Optimal Ticket Sales Strategy
Choosing the right ticket sales strategy can significantly impact the success of an event. A waitlist strategy is found to be more effective as it instills urgency among potential attendees, prompting quicker decisions to purchase tickets. When people know that tickets are limited and sales will occur at a specific time, it generates a fear of missing out (FOMO), encouraging them to act fast. This method can be supplemented by offering early bird discounts to reward timely purchases, ensuring that initial ticket sales remain strong.
